**The Barometer of Data: The Bar Chart**
Ah, the bar chart – a familiar face in data analytics. It’s straightforward and yet incredibly versatile. Its rectangular bars, which can be vertical or horizontal, stand like soldiers against a backdrop of axes, readily communicating comparisons or rankings. Whether measuring sales figures, populations, or average temperatures, the bar chart is an effective means to highlight individual data points, categories, or cumulative totals. This foundational chart type is particularly beneficial when showcasing relationships between discrete, independent variables.

**The Pie in the Sky: Pie Charts**
Pie charts are the most colorful, and sometimes the polarizing, elements of data visualization. Similar to a sliced pie, these circular graphs divide entire datasets into proportions, with each slice representing a part of the whole. While they can be eye-catching, pie charts are not always the best choice for complex data, especially when there are too many categories or the categories are highly skewed. They serve best when illustrating simple proportions and comparisons that are easy to interpret at a glance.
**The Cluster of Information: Scatter Plots**
Step beyond the one-dimensional and explore the multidimensional with scatter plots. By plotting points on a two-dimensional grid, these graphs use individual dots to represent an empirical relationship between two variables. Scatter plots are instrumental when analyzing correlations, trends, and distributions. They can help to identify clusters, outliers, and even indicate a negative, positive, or no relationship between the variables.
**Dots and Dashes: Bubble Charts**
Bubble charts are a unique variation on the scatter plot, introducing a third dimension by adding a third variable. The volume of the bubble serves as a proxy for the third variable, typically magnitude. This additional layer can be powerful when examining the interplay of multiple factors and the impact they have on a dataset. Bubble charts are especially useful for economic, demographic, or geological datasets, where scale is crucial.

**The Cloud of Words: Word Clouds**
For textual data, word clouds take center stage. They transform frequency data into a visually stunning, word-scaled design. Words that occur more frequently in a given text are displayed in larger font size, whereas less frequent words shrink. Word clouds aren’t about data precision; they are about immediate sentiment analysis, brand perception, or general mood and frequency of terms.
